Take a trip back in time to the Lake County of yesterday through 192 pages of historical maps, charts, and photos- nearly 300- along with a fascinating narrative.  This remarkable volume chronicles the wise and wherefores of the county's beginnings and provides detailed histories of twenty- three cities and towns.  Recall facts and faces from around Lake County and enjoy the lively anecdotal stories that will warm your heart.

Lake County was the first county in the United States to have its own flag.  You can buy a flag set consisting of Old Glory, our State flag, and of course Lake County's own flag all on a wooden base for only $10 at our office on W. Main Street.
